so i went for a ride out in the pits and i ended up swamping my 08 z400. i drained out my air box and pulled out the plug and cranked it over, and i changed the oil. then just after going back out again i noticed the over heating light came on. the antifreeze was boiling and it was just a mess. i changed out the antifreeze thinking that maybe i some water got into the overflow. this whole time the fan just wouldn't turn on. and it wont turn on at all. so im thinking i loaded the wiring harness with water. i know it must be electrical, but could you guys just name the part and possibly just tell me the price? thanks. id like to get the fan turning and riding again

before looking for a new fan check the fuse on the radiator there is one there that i have had blow on me before and wont let the fan run so check that out before you do any thing else hope this helps you out

Check the fuse first, if that's not it pull the electrical connector on the lower radiator plug and jump the wires in the plug. If the fan comes on you need a new temp switch, about $40.
There's a method to test it in the manual with a multimeter and a pan of hot water.

thanks alot you guys. it was a fuse. it was mounted by a rubber clamp to the radiator. i appreciate your input and im sorry for the reply delay. my computer was being fixed.
